- Description
- 1 print : engraving; plate mark 18 x 22 cm., on sheet 32 x 40 cm.
- Summary
- Ream wrapper, illustrated with view of Hudson's paper mill (at the middle falls of the Hockanum, at Scotland, now Burnside, East Hartford) in a landscape.
